Hooton, William James

War Service:
Sapper 22518 WILLIAM JAMES HOOTON of 5 Field Company, Royal Engineers was killed in action on 6 November 1914, aged 24.

He is buried in Hooge Crater Cemetery.

Location of Memorial:
He is remembered in the Book of Remembrance at St Saviour’s church Forest Hill.

Details:
He was born in Peckham. He joined the Royal Engineers in February 1912, having previously worked as a carpenter and joiner. He went to France on 7 October 1914. He was the son of William and Mary Hooton of 16, Como Rd., Forest Hill.
